Month: 2025-08 — Delivered a performance-focused feature in Monkestation/Monkelith: Atmospheric Simulation Speed Improvement, with licensing attribution updates. This work aligns with ongoing volumetrics initiatives and enhances runtime responsiveness. Key features delivered: - Atmospheric Simulation Speed Improvement: Increased atmos.speedup CVar from 2f to 8f to accelerate atmospheric condition simulation; includes automatic updates to REUSE headers for licensing attribution. Commit: 450c18cd9e7eb24e0082e1819433584fd549d7ab (Unstrangle Volumetrics #1720). Major bugs fixed: - None reported this month. Overall impact and accomplishments: - Improved runtime responsiveness for atmospheric simulations; licensing attribution automation; alignment with volumetrics work. Technologies/skills demonstrated: - CVar tuning, performance optimization, licensing automation, and change management in Monkestation/Monkelith.
